Review: Blue Unicorn Poop Moonrock by Kaviar

Illinois News Joint

Blue Unicorn Poop is an indica-leaning hybrid cross of Blue Sherbet and Unicorn Poop. Best results were had when the moonrock bubbled in the bowl, like old-school hash. The effects came on before I had finished the bowl with a heavy physical indica blanket of pressure paired with a closed in awareness and a mind wiped clean of thought.

Review: GMO Live Rosin by Aer?z

Illinois News Joint

Hunting for the right strains to produce quality hash rosin is more art than science, but one cultivar has become a trusted “washable” strain, GMO. GMO is an indica-leaning hybrid cross of Chemdawg and GSC. ILNJ photo This gram presented as a messy clump of deep amber-orange badder.
